Phil Mickelson Net Worth 2024: Current Estimate and Career Earnings

Phil Mickelson net worth 2024 is estimated at around $400 million, based on PGA Tour prize money, Ryder Cup bonuses, and off-course earnings reported by Forbes and other financial outlets. His career PGA Tour earnings exceed $100 million, with major championship wins adding significant bonuses and appearance fees to his total income.

Mickelson has earned substantial sums through PGA Tour events, including the 2021 PGA Championship at The Ocean Course at Kiawah Island Golf Resort, which added to his major tally and increased his overall market value. His 2023 and 2024 PGA Tour appearances, including the Genesis Invitational and Arnold Palmer Invitational, contributed to his prize money totals and kept him among the highest-earning active players.

Phil Mickelson Business Ventures and Endorsements

Mickelson's wealth includes major endorsement deals with companies such as Callaway Golf, Rolex, and Workday, as well as equity stakes and business partnerships that diversify his portfolio beyond tournament winnings. He has also been involved in ventures related to sports media and golf course design, which add to his annual income streams.

His relationship with Callaway Golf, including equity ownership and product lines, has been a key part of his commercial strategy, with details reported in financial coverage from Forbes and Golf Digest. Mickelson's off-course activities also include real estate investments and high-profile appearances that support his overall brand value and net worth.

Phil Mickelson Financial Profile and Public Records

Public filings, SEC documents, and investigative reports have highlighted Mickelson's involvement in insider trading matters related to Dean Foods stock, which resulted in a settlement with the SEC and a financial penalty. The SEC case, detailed on the official SEC website, noted that Mickelson profited from trades based on material nonpublic information provided by Billy Walters.

Mickelson has publicly addressed the Dean Foods trading case, stating he cooperated with investigators and paid the associated penalties, as reported by CNBC and the SEC's public records. His financial profile continues to be shaped by PGA Tour earnings, endorsement income, and business activities, with his net worth reflecting both his golf career and his broader commercial interests.
